| PF04321 | RmlD substrate binding domain (RmlD_sub_bind) | RmlD substrate binding domain | L-rhamnose is a saccharide required for the virulence of some bacteria. Its precursor, dTDP-L-rhamnose, is synthesised by four different enzymes the final one of which is RmlD. The RmlD substrate binding domain is responsible for binding a sugar nucl ... | Domain |
